Assessing Your Commercial Site for Native Plant Success
Before selecting a single plant, map the site like an operator, not a gardener. Commercial outdoor projects fail when everyone talks about “full sun” and “shade” as if those are simple categories. On an office park, retail center, or campus, actual conditions are shaped by pavement, building orientation, overhangs, wind channels, stormwater flow, and maintenance access.

Start with a property microclimate map
Think of the site as a set of operating zones. The bed at the monument sign isn't the same environment as the courtyard behind a parking garage, even if they're on the same property.
Walk the site and mark:
- South and west exposures: These areas typically take the harshest heat load and reflected light.
- North-facing foundation beds: These can stay cooler and dimmer, especially under overhangs.
- Tree-influenced zones: Mature canopy changes both light and root competition.
- Pavement-adjacent islands: These spots deal with radiant heat, compacted soil, and irrigation drift.
- Low spots and runoff paths: Water collects here even when the rest of the site dries out fast.
If a bed fails repeatedly, the cause is often visible during a walk at different times of day. Morning shade can turn into punishing afternoon exposure. A shaded courtyard may also have poor air circulation and shallow imported soil. Those are very different planting conditions.
Check the soil before you buy plants
North Texas sites often give you either heavy clay, disturbed construction fill, sandy loam in pockets, or some layered combination of all three. Don't assume uniform conditions across the property.
A practical field check includes:
- Texture test: Moisten a handful of soil. If it forms a slick ribbon, you're dealing with more clay. If it falls apart quickly, drainage may move faster.
- Infiltration observation: Fill a small test hole with water and watch how quickly it disappears. Slow movement points to compaction or clay issues.
- Root-zone inspection: Dig far enough to see whether you have usable topsoil or a shallow layer over rubble and construction debris.
When a plant underperforms on a commercial site, poor soil structure is often the hidden culprit, not the species itself.
Separate high-traffic from passive landscape areas
This step gets overlooked. A shaded plant that thrives in a quiet courtyard may fail along a retail walkway because people brush past it, maintenance carts clip it, or litter service disturbs the bed edge.
Break the site into use patterns:
- Entry statements: Need clean structure, visibility, and a controlled look.
- Pedestrian corridors: Need durability and predictable mature size.
- Screening zones: Can use larger masses and looser forms.
- Passive visual areas: Allow for more textural planting and habitat value.
Include constraints before design begins
Commercial sites have rules that shape plant selection long before aesthetics come into play. Sightlines at drives, fire access, signage visibility, overhead conflicts, drainage easements, and municipal requirements all affect what belongs where.
That's why a good site assessment includes more than horticulture. It also includes operations. Who maintains the property? How often are crews on site? Does the irrigation system support hydrozoning, or is everything on broad spray coverage? Those answers decide whether a native concept will work in practice or only on a rendering.
A simple site map that marks light, soil, drainage, traffic, and constraints will save more money than any last-minute plant substitution ever will.
Strategic Water Management for Native Landscapes
A property looks sharp at turnover, then July hits. Beds near the parking lot bake, shaded entries stay damp, the controller keeps running the same schedule everywhere, and water bills climb while plant quality slips. On commercial sites, that pattern is rarely a plant problem. It is usually a water-use problem.
Native plants in North Texas can cut long-term irrigation demand, but only if the system matches the planting plan. During the first season, roots are still limited to the amended backfill and immediate surrounding soil. That means new installations need consistent, targeted moisture until roots push outward. If crews under-water during establishment, managers often pay twice, once for replacement material and again for extra labor to reset the bed.
Establishment water is different from long-term water
The first objective is root development, not fast top growth. Deep, measured applications usually outperform frequent shallow cycles because they encourage plants to root down where moisture lasts longer. After establishment, irrigation should be reduced and spaced out based on exposure, soil, and plant type.
That shift has direct budget value.
Owners and property managers who plan for an establishment period usually get better survival rates and fewer warranty disputes. They also have a clear point when irrigation can be recalibrated instead of left on an installation setting for months too long. Retrofits usually beat blanket watering
Many older commercial properties still run broad sprays against foundations, sidewalks, and bed edges. In North Texas clay, that often creates runoff before water reaches the full root zone. The result is familiar. Wet pavement, dry plants, algae on concrete, and avoidable waste.
A few targeted upgrades usually produce better returns than a full system replacement:
- Drip irrigation for shrub and perennial beds: Delivers water closer to the root zone and reduces overspray on walks, glass, and walls.
- MP rotators in turf-adjacent areas: Apply water more slowly than conventional sprays, which helps on tight soils.
- Cycle-and-soak programming: Shorter repeat cycles give heavy soils time to absorb water instead of shedding it.
- Weather-based controllers and sensors: Help maintenance teams adjust to actual conditions instead of running a fixed seasonal habit.
Precision matters more with native plantings because the goal is durability, not constant stimulation. Overwatering often creates weak growth, disease pressure, and a softer appearance that does not hold up well in high-visibility commercial settings.
Match hydrozones to actual site conditions
Grouping plants by real water use is where many commercial properties either save money or keep wasting it. A shaded courtyard, a west-facing foundation, and a parking lot island should not run on the same schedule just because they were tied to the same valve years ago.
This matters even more on sites with shade-tolerant native species. Those plants are often chosen to solve a practical commercial problem: dark building edges, tree-covered pedestrian routes, and courtyards that need a finished look without constant replacement. Yet they are commonly overwatered because they share irrigation with hotter zones nearby. The plants survive, but the bed never looks crisp, and maintenance crews spend more time correcting decline, thinning growth, and fungal issues than they should.
Use a simple review table before changing schedules:
| Irrigation question | Why it matters |
|---|---|
| Does this zone reflect heat from pavement or walls? | Hotter areas usually dry faster and need a different schedule |
| Does water stand after a short run time? | Infiltration is limiting performance |
| Are shaded native selections grouped apart from full-sun material? | Mixed exposure on one valve leads to chronic overwatering or stress |
| Is the controller adjusted by season and recent weather? | Static programs often waste water and weaken plant quality |
Well-zoned irrigation supports stronger plant performance, lower replacement costs, and a cleaner appearance across the property. This represents the return. Lower water use, fewer avoidable service calls, and planting beds that hold their form in heat, shade, and day-to-day commercial wear.
Designing with North Texas Native Plant Palettes
A property manager walks the site after a summer storm. The entry beds still read clean. The shaded walk to the lobby looks finished instead of thin and patchy. The frontage holds a consistent look without constant seasonal replacement. That is what a good native plant palette should deliver on a commercial property.

Building Layers That Read as Intentional
Single-height shrub beds rarely justify their upkeep. They expose too much mulch, show gaps quickly, and tend to look tired between pruning cycles.
A stronger planting composition uses layers with clear jobs:
- Low edging and groundcover to tighten bed lines and reduce bare mulch
- Perennials and accent forms to add seasonal color and movement
- Shrub masses to hold structure through most of the year
- Trees or large focal plants to scale entries, corners, and gathering areas
That structure protects appearance and budget at the same time. If one plant group has a rough stretch from heat, cold, or foot traffic, the bed still reads complete because the visual weight is spread across several layers.
Year-round appearance matters more on commercial sites than many plant lists acknowledge. Bloom is only one part of the equation. Texture, evergreen presence, branching habit, fall color, and seed heads all help beds hold their value outside peak flowering periods. Solving the Commercial Shade Challenge
Shade is where many native recommendations get thin. In practice, most guidance centers on sun and drought performance, while shaded commercial zones are treated as an afterthought. Yet those are some of the most visible and troublesome areas on a property. North-facing foundations, covered pedestrian routes, courtyards, and tree-shaded parking edges all need plants that stay full, read clean, and do not demand frequent replacement.
On commercial sites, shade failures are usually slow and expensive. A poor species match may survive for months or years, but the bed loses density, color, and shape. Crews spend more time trimming around decline, replacing scattered losses, and trying to make weak material look intentional.
Three natives deserve serious consideration for these conditions:
- Turk's Cap: Reliable for shaded masses where a softer form and extended color help break up hard building lines
- Southern Wood Fern: Useful in protected beds with better soil and a cooler microclimate
- Coralberry: Good for understory structure, natural screening, and filling space under filtered light
I see the same pattern across commercial accounts. The hardest bed to keep looking polished is often the shaded one with reflected building shade, compacted soil, and limited air movement. A plant list built only around full-sun performers will miss that problem.
Palettes That Perform Better on Real Sites
The best native palettes start with use, visibility, and maintenance tolerance. Style comes after that. A corporate office entry usually benefits from repeated masses, controlled color, and clean spacing. Hospitality and multifamily sites can carry more softness near doors, seating areas, and pedestrian routes. Industrial properties often need bolder forms that read well from the drive aisle and hold up with less attention.
Use this framework during design review:
| Design goal | Better-performing native approach |
|---|---|
| Clean corporate appearance | Repeated masses, limited species count, strong structural backbone |
| Softer hospitality character | Layered flowering perennials, understory shrubs, shade-tolerant accents near walkways |
| Better performance in drainage shifts | Place species by soil moisture behavior, not bloom color |
| Longer visual interest | Combine plants with staggered bloom, foliage, berry, or form changes through the year |
Commercial native design needs discipline. Repetition, clear bed edges, mature spacing, and access for crews all affect long-term cost. A frontage planted to look loose and residential may sound attractive on paper, but it often reads messy from the street and takes more labor to keep presentable. A tighter palette usually gives owners a better return through lower replacement, cleaner appearance, and fewer corrective maintenance hours.
Tailored Native Plant Lists for Your Commercial Property
A plant list that works on one commercial site can fail on the next. The difference usually comes down to visibility, irrigation coverage, foot traffic, reflected heat, and one issue managers often underestimate: usable shade near buildings and parking structures. Shade-tolerant natives are harder to choose well, especially when the site still needs a clean, maintained appearance.
Use the list below as a budgeting and specification tool, not just a design reference.
| Property Type | Full Sun Priority | Shade-Tolerant Priority | High-Visibility Accent |
|---|---|---|---|
| Office and Corporate | Texas Sage | Turk's Cap | Red Yucca |
| Retail and Hospitality | Red Yucca | Coralberry | Turk's Cap |
| Industrial and Logistics | Texas Sage | Southern Wood Fern | Red Yucca |
| HOA and Multifamily | Texas Sage | Turk's Cap | Coralberry |
Office and Corporate Campuses
Office properties are judged up close. Tenants notice weak shrub masses, thin beds at the main entry, and plants that outgrow their space. The best native choices keep a disciplined appearance without pushing up pruning hours.
A dependable office planting list often includes:
- Texas Sage in full sun areas: Best where heat and glare are high and there is enough room for mature width.
- Turk's Cap along shaded building edges: Useful under tree canopies or on the north and east sides of buildings where many sun-loving natives thin out.
- Red Yucca at entries and signs: Strong vertical form helps break up low shrub groupings and keeps sightlines open.

Retail and Hospitality Properties
Retail and hospitality sites have a narrower margin for error. Beds are often smaller, pedestrian traffic is heavier, and the planting has to read well from both the curb and the sidewalk. Showy plants help, but only if they stay inside the bedline and do not trap trash or obstruct storefront visibility.
Good options include:
- Red Yucca for sunny entries and medians: It holds form well and reads clearly from a distance.
- Coralberry for shaded walkways and protected edges: Better where softer texture is wanted without constant clipping.
- Turk's Cap near seating areas or storefront transitions: Useful in protected shade where color and fullness matter.
The trade-off is maintenance discipline. A plant that looks soft and welcoming can still be the wrong choice if it sprawls into walkways or needs frequent cleanup.
Industrial and Logistics Sites
Industrial sites reward restraint. Long frontages, broad pavement areas, and lower irrigation intensity favor plants that can handle heat, wind, and occasional neglect without collapsing visually.
For these properties, keep the list short:
- Texas Sage for exposed sunny runs where durability matters more than seasonal variety
- Southern Wood Fern for shaded office zones or protected side elevations
- Red Yucca where the property needs a low-input accent with good visibility from the road
Owners often improve ROI by simplifying the spec. Larger blocks of fewer species reduce replacement ordering, make crew training easier, and produce a cleaner appearance at truck-entry speed.
HOA and Multifamily Communities
HOA and multifamily properties have to satisfy residents, board members, and maintenance budgets at the same time. Repetition helps. Residents recognize recurring plant groups, and crews spend less time identifying one-off species with different pruning and irrigation needs.
A practical native mix often includes:
- Texas Sage in sunny perimeter beds and street-facing zones
- Turk's Cap in shaded courtyards or building-side beds
- Coralberry where an understory mass can connect trees, shrubs, and pedestrian areas
Shade performance matters more here than many teams expect. Courtyards, breezeways, and building shadows can make a sun-based plant list fail fast.
A good commercial plant list stays short, readable, and easy for crews to maintain consistently.
For pricing and approvals, sort candidates by property type, then narrow the list by three filters: full sun, practical shade, and visibility to tenants, customers, or residents. That approach usually produces better plant survival, fewer replacements, and a stronger year-round presentation.
Planting and Maintenance Schedules for Long-Term Value
A property manager signs off on native plants to cut water use and replacement costs, then gets frustrated six months later because half the beds look uneven and the irrigation schedule still runs like a high-input annual rotation. The problem usually starts at install and gets worse in the first year. Native plantings pay back well on commercial sites, but only when planting depth, irrigation checks, mulch placement, and crew instructions are handled with discipline.

Installation Choices That Protect the Investment
For most North Texas commercial properties, fall gives the best planting window. Soil stays workable, air temperatures are less punishing, and roots get time to establish before summer stress hits. Spring installations can still succeed, but they usually demand tighter irrigation oversight and leave less margin for error on heat-sensitive sites, especially around reflective paving and west-facing building edges.
The install phase should cover four basics well:
- Correct planting depth: Keep the root flare or crown at the proper grade. Plants set too deep often decline slowly, which makes warranty disputes and replacement decisions harder.
- Targeted soil correction: Break up compaction and fix obvious drainage issues in problem areas instead of over-amending every bed and driving up cost.
- Clean mulch application: Mulch should hold moisture and limit weed pressure, not sit against stems or trunks.
- Irrigation verification on day one: Run every zone after install. Coverage gaps around signs, corners, and shaded walls show up quickly on commercial sites.

A Realistic Commercial Maintenance Rhythm
The first year requires active management. After establishment, the work changes shape and usually gets less expensive.
That shift matters for ROI. Crews spend less time on rescue watering, emergency replacement, and corrective pruning when the schedule matches how native plantings mature.
| Timeframe | Priority tasks |
|---|---|
| Early establishment | Check irrigation coverage, correct settling and washouts, remove invasive weeds before they seed |
| First warm season | Watch for stress near pavement and walls, adjust run times by zone, keep mulch in place |
| Dormant or cool season | Cut back selected perennials and grasses where appearance or safety requires it, inspect edges and sightlines |
| Mature phase | Reduce irrigation where plants have established well, spot-weed, prune for structure, refresh mulch only where needed |
Commercial crews often run into trouble when they maintain native beds like tightly clipped foundation shrub areas. That approach wastes labor and can ruin plant form. Native material still needs attention, but the standard is plant health, visibility, and order, not uniform shearing.
A few practices protect both appearance and budget:
- Weed early: Small weed outbreaks are cheap to remove. Large infestations turn into repeated labor and fresh mulch expense.
- Prune for structure: Keep natural form where possible, but clear walks, entries, monument signs, and driver sightlines.
- Adjust irrigation by season and exposure: A shaded courtyard zone should not be watered like a full-sun parking lot edge.
- Replace with the original spec or an approved equivalent: Random substitutions usually create mixed growth habits and more maintenance exceptions.
Shade deserves extra attention in this schedule. On commercial properties, shaded native areas near buildings often stay wet longer, grow more slowly, and can look thin if crews apply the same pruning and watering pattern used in sunny frontage beds. Separate expectations by exposure, and the planting will hold its appearance with fewer corrections.
Low-maintenance plantings still need observation. The savings come from fewer avoidable interventions, lower replacement volume, and maintenance hours spent on planned care instead of cleanup.
